Giulia Balestra leads research on humanitarian innovation, technology and forced displacement at the UN Refugee Agency’s Innovation Service. She is interested in ethical and human rights-based approaches to digital technologies. Through her work, she seeks to reimagine what a more inclusive and just future could look like, both online and offline.

Giulia has worked for various international organizations in East Africa and Europe, providing expertise on communication, ethnographic research, product development and User Experience (UX) research and design, and project management.

She has a background in Social and Medical Anthropology and Social innovation Management.
